2012-05-31 120 views
0

我一直在想,如果有可能添加參數爲資產樹枝功能這樣在Symfony2的樹枝資產功能

#config.yml 
... 
framework: 
    templating: 
     parameters: 
     key: value 
OR 
twig: 
    parameters: 
     key: value 
... 

而且在樹枝文件使用資產這樣

# twig file 
<script src="{{ asset('/file/path', key) }}"></script> 
添加參數

而且將重新

<script src="/file/path?key=value"></script> 

我知道我可以創建一個宏,要做到這一點,但我想知道是否有一個另一種方式。

感謝您的回覆

+0

你知道了嗎? – codecowboy

+0

[如何在Symfony2 Twig模板中獲取配置參數](https://stackoverflow.com/questions/6787895/how-to-get-config-parameters-in-symfony2-twig-templates) – Martijn

回答

0

資產一般都是靜態的文件,而不是動態腳本,你確定你做了正確的事情?如果你有一個接受參數的資產,可能它應該是一個控制器中的一個路由,因此你可以在代碼中對其進行操作,否則,資產唯一讓你做的事情是自動附加一個版本號到資產使用assets_version

+0

assets_Version是什麼我在尋找,非常感謝 – Particule42